importorg.jsoup.Jsoup;importorg.jsoup.nodes.Document;Documentdoc=Jsoup.parse(htmlContent); 1. 2. 3. 4. 3. 创建 Word 文档 然后,使用Apache POI创建一个新的 Word 文档: importorg.apache.poi.xwpf.usermodel.*;XWPFDocumentdocument=newXWPFDocument(); 1. 2. 3. 4. 写入内容 现在,我们从解析的 HTM...
步骤一:将 HTML 内容转换为 Word 文档 在这一步中,我们需要使用 Apache POI 库来将 HTML 内容转换为 Word 文档。以下是示例代码: // 创建一个新的 Word 文档XWPFDocumentdocument=newXWPFDocument();// 在文档中添加段落XWPFParagraphparagraph=document.createParagraph();// 设置段落的样式paragraph.setStyle("Headi...
1 将Word jar包Free Spire.Doc for Java下载到本地,解压,找到lib文件夹下的jar文件。2 在IDEA中打开如下界面,手动导入本地路径下的jar文件到java程序。3 找到本地路径下的jar文件,点击“OK”,勾选选项,点击“Apply”,完成引入jar到Java程序。4 引用完成后,编辑如下代码实现转换:import com.spire.doc.*...
(1) 由于导出的html网页格式,打开word后,默认显示的视图模式为WEB版式视图; (2) 修改word文档后,会新增一个相关联的文件夹,word的html中会引用这个文件夹中的资源,比如样式、图片、主题等;这样如果只转移word文档本身,会造成找不到相关联的资源。 (3) 由于我们有些字段内容是采用富文本编辑器(百度的UEditor)填...
word本身是可以识别html标签,所以通过poi写入html内容即可 import com.util.WordUtil; import org.springframework.web.bind.annotation.PostMapping;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letResponse; public class SysAnnouncementController { ...
由于在项目中需要将富文本生成的HTML文档内容导出为word,并且里面的图片可能来自于用户上传,也可能是来源于网络图片,因此需要在生成的word中做特别的处理。导出的工具使用freemaker,首先说明的是这个也有一定的局限性,在样式匹配度上可能有一定的差异,不过功能是没问题的,先看一下示例。 这是最初设置的模板: 替换的...
*@Function: html 转为纯文本 保留格式 *@Class Name: WebFormatter *@Author: zhangZhiPeng *@Date: 2013-10-29 *@Modifications: *@Modifier Name; Date; The Reason for Modifying * */ public class WebFormatter{ public static void main(String[] args){ ...
Java将html页面导出成word文件,隐藏了部分的div。导出成word的时候div也显示出来了有没有解决的办法?就是保持我页面的格式然后导出成word,页面显示的时候是隐藏了部分的div。如果没办法只能在jsp中把隐藏的div给删了。我想的是,导出成word的时候能不能识别jsp中的样式,比如说这个div已经有隐藏的样式了。然后导出就...
.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head runat="server"> <title>无标题页</title> </head> <body> <form id="form1" runat="server"> <div> <asp:Button ID="Button1" runat="server" Text="Button" OnClick="Button1_Click" /> </div> </form> </body> </html...
1.首先我们需要建立一个word导出的工具类: /** * html 导出 word 工具类 * @author zhangxiang * */ public class WordUtil { public static void exportWord(HttpServletRequest request, HttpServletResponse response, String content, String fileName) throws Exception { ...